The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) is an international organisation comprised of 38 member countries that works to build better policies for better lives. Our mission is to promote policies that will improve the economic and social well-being of people around the world. Together with governments, policy makers and citizens, we work on establishing evidence-based international standards, and finding solutions to a range of social, economic and environmental challenges. From improving economic performance and creating jobs to fostering strong education and fighting international tax evasion, we provide a unique forum and knowledge hub for data and analysis, exchange of experiences, best-practice sharing, and advice on public policies and international standard-setting.
The Directorate for Global Relations and Co-operation (GRC) co-ordinates the Organisation’s relations with partner countries and with other international organisations. It advises the Office of the Secretary-General and other OECD Directorates on how to strengthen co-operation with partner countries, regions and organisations. GRC also serves the OECD External Relations Committee (ERC), working with members to help them reach consensus on global relations priorities and ensuring that relevant partners are effectively engaged in the Organisation’s work in delivering on the Organisation’s Global Relations Strategy and the Secretary-General’s strategic orientations.
GRC is looking for one or more Advisors/Economists/Policy Analysts with knowledge and experience in one or more of several regions, including South East Europe, the Middle East and North Africa, Africa, Central Asia, the Eastern Partner Region, Latin America, China, India and Southeast Asia, to perform a variety of roles. The selected persons will perform a range of tasks in support of the delivery of the GRC Divisions’ substantive work programmes, which encompass such diverse policy domains as digitalisation, green growth and sustainability, trade and transport connectivity, business environment reforms, gender, SME policies and newly emerging issues to support GRC’s horizontal coordination of OECD global relations. They may also be called upon to prepare internal documents, such as briefings and talking points for senior management, as well as notes for the OECD’s Council and its External Relations Committee, work programmes, country programmes and memoranda of understanding; the conduct of research, policy analysis and advice on substantive policies; liaison and communications; and event organisation and management. The selected person(s) will work under the supervision of the relevant Head(s) of Division in GRC.
